Host D.C. explores the Puerto Rican boogeyman—El Cuco (also called Cucu/Cucuoy)—and how this folklore was used by parents to scare kids into good behavior. He shares personal memories of growing up, the story’s Spanish and indigenous roots, and how the legend changed after families moved to the United States.
The episode connects these childhood warnings to broader cultural practices, pop-culture references (like The X-Files and The Village), and how Halloween amplifies monster tales. D.C. reflects on how folklore adapts across places and generations.
A short, conversational dive into fear, parenting, and cultural storytelling—mixing humor, nostalgia, and observation.
